What happened on my birthday – Feb 8th?

These were the events that made history that coincide with your birthday.

  • 1347
    The Byzantine civil war of 1341–47 ends with a power-sharing agreement between John VI Kantakouzenos and John V Palaiologos.
  • 1807
    Battle of Eylau – Napoleon defeats Russians under General Bennigsen and the Prussians under L'Estocq
  • 1879
    Sandford Fleming first proposes adoption of Universal Standard Time at a meeting of the Royal Canadian Institute.
  • 1885
    The first government-approved Japanese immigrants arrived in Hawaii.
  • 1910
    The Boy Scouts of America is incorporated by William D. Boyce.
  • 1924
    Capital punishment: The first state execution in the United States by gas chamber takes place in Nevada.
  • 1948
    The formal creation of the Korean People’s Army of North Korea is announced.
  • 1955
    The Government of Sindh, Pakistan, abolishes the Jagirdari system in the province. One million acres (4000 km2) of land thus acquired is to be distributed among the landless peasants.
  • 1971
    The NASDAQ stock market index opens for the first time.
  • 1978
    Proceedings of the United States Senate are broadcast on radio for the first time.

What is a good birthday trivia for February 8?

In a room of 23 people there’s a 50% chance of two individuals having the same birthday (month and day only and not a leap year). The chance increases to 99.9% if there are 70 people in the room. You need at least 253 people in the room if you want someone to have the same birthday as you with 50% probability. This is called the birthday paradox or birthday problem.
